This book reviews the environmental conditions and chemical changes in Polish surface waters, shaped by historical glaciations. Expert contributors discuss the effects of climate on water reservoirs, the hydrographic network, eutrophication, and pollution sources, particularly chemical contamination. It serves as a resource for various environmental professionals.

This book reviews recent research on biodiversity and biocontamination in Poland's aquatic ecosystems. It analyzes the biological status of surface waters, covering various elements such as macrophytes, phytoplankton, and fish, and includes conservation practices and protected site reviews. It serves as a resource for students and environmental professionals.
